In Ingglish — phonetic English where every spelling always makes the same sound — the word “discovered” is spelled “diskuhverd”. Here is how it sounds out, one sound at a time:
| Ingglish | d | i | s | k | uh | v | er | d |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| IPA | /d/ | /ɪ/ | /s/ | /k/ | /ʌ/ | /v/ | /ɝ/ | /d/ |
English writes “discovered” with
10 letters for 8 sounds. Ingglish writes it
“diskuhverd” — no silent letters, and the same spelling
always makes the same sound, so you can read it exactly as it looks.

“discovered” — questions & answers
How do you pronounce “discovered”?
“discovered” is pronounced di-SKUH-verd — IPA /dɪˈskʌvɝd/. In Ingglish phonetic spelling, where every spelling always makes the same sound, it is written “diskuhverd”.
How many syllables are in “discovered”?
“discovered” has 3 syllables: di-SKUH-verd (the capitalized syllable is stressed).
